Prayer & Worship

We are a community seeking God, primarily through prayer and worship together. We gather daily to pray and worship, aiming to create a special space at SPB for His presence. Besides our community activities, we serve as a house of prayer for North London and hold prayer events for the area. Our chapel is open for personal prayer and retreats.

The Open

On the third Wednesday of every other month we host the ‘Open’ where anyone is invited to join our resident community for an evening of prayer and worship in the chapel from 7.30pm. Future dates TBC

House of Prayer & Worship

St Peter's Bourne is also a house of prayer and worship where individuals can pray and where will host led times of corporate intercession and worship. (This aspect of SPB is currently paused and will restart later in 2026).

Community Rhythm

Our community rhythm at St Peter’s Bourne includes morning prayers together and on Wednesday evenings we eat together and have a time of prayer and worship time as a community. During the day the chapel is regularly used by community members and others wanting to pray or intercede for North London.
